MARGARET HALEY is a composer of chamber, orchestral and vocal music based in West Yorkshire (UK).

Her working methods show a concern for mapping techniques as a means of skeletal construction, prior to staff notation. Often achieving an air of mystery, particularly in her instrumental projects, Margaret’s visual approach is tempered by her desire for shaping sound: Primary Colours (2003) and Black Hole (2008) two works for string orchestra alongside Cloud (2005) for saxophone quartet, explore this concept.

Margaret's growing catalogue of choral music include two a cappella works for SATB voices, the award-winning Mother Mary Sing (2003) and The Poppy Field (2008), both of which received acclaim.  As runner-up in the New Cambridge Singers Renaissance Reimagined composition competition (2016), Margaret was invited to reimagine A Fisherman's Baby for SATB voices (with divisi) & organ (2017).

 

Born in England (Coventry) in 1954, Margaret began her musical life at the age of seven by receiving piano and music theory lessons before developing a real passion for classical guitar in her mid-teens.

 

Already an established freelance instrumental music teacher, Margaret Haley embarked on further academic study as a mature student at the University of Huddersfield, where she studied composition with the guidance of her supervisors Christopher Fox, James Saunders, and latterly Monty Adkins and Bryn Harrison. On completion of her music undergraduate course (2000) Margaret’s burgeoning interest in contemporary music led to more in-depth research. Firstly, for her Master of Arts degree, as a result, she achieved an overall distinction alongside the prestigious postgraduate music prize in 2003. And, secondly in 2010, she was awarded a PhD in composition, in partial fulfilment of her portfolio of compositions Margaret's doctoral thesis: Drawing Sound in Time: A Commentary on my Recent Music investigates a visual approach.

In addition to academic study Margaret Haley was appointed instrumental teacher of guitar for Wakefield Music Services (September 2000-December 2004). This post afforded an opportunity to write educational material specifically for guitar ensembles (beginners - advanced level) in performance: Bugs (2002), Fishy Story (2004) and Wintertime (2004).
